Definitions
To wander in a wrong path; to stray; to go astray.
intransitive
Examples
“Her weary palfrey, closely as she might, Now well recover'd after long repast, In his proud furnitures she freshly dight, His late miswander'd ways now to remeasure right”
“Or show you restless, miswandering, misclimbing ones new and easier footpaths?”
“The reason for this attitude toward Spain is not far to seek, and it finds an explanation in the words of José Ortega Gasset, quoted by Mr. Trend: Is it not bitter sarcasm that after and a half centuries of miswandering we are invited to follow the ....”
“As if it were a maze where these orphans of his heart had miswandered in their journey in life […]”
